Hello. I'm looking to replace my dads old office pc thats running an old 3rd gen i5 to one of the new ryzen apus with vega graphics. should be a good upgrade. but i am having an issue choosing a case. i would like it to be a fairly small matx unit with a more closed off and sleek design as to not get dusty living in an office, and it also needs a 5.25 drive bay for a blu ray burner. not looking to spend a ton on just the case; sub 70usd. if theres anything like the fractal define nano s or nzxt h200i but with a 5.25 drive bay that would be perfect. i know those are itx cases but that's the style i'm looking for; small cube, space efficient, not an eyesore with lights or fan grills everywhere. his office does get dusty, so someting with minimal side or top vents to keep dust from settling inside a powered off system would be ideal. i thank all those who leave suggestions in advance.

edit: i could go itx, but would much rather prefer the option to put in additional usb or a sound card through pcie ports.
